John Dow, Canberra, Australia. 10,500 planes . Back in 2024, FlightAware determined there to be an average of 9,728 commercial airplanesin the sky at any given time. Of course, that number fluctuates on a minute-by-minute basis, given that planes are nearly constantly taking off and landing.
